Abstract
This paper presents experiments of the fixed protrusion on the enclosure defect on a 220 kV GIS equipment using UHF partial discharge measurement. PD data was captured by UHF detection used an oscilloscope and stored as phase resolved pulse sequence (PRPS) data. Then, the multiple PD patterns such as phase resolved pulse sequence analysis (PRPSA) pattern, phase resolved partial discharge (PRPD) pattern and Δu pattern can be calculated from the PRPS data sets. In addition, partial discharge trend curves are also to be used to depict the PD developed process. The multiple discharge patterns and PD parameters observed in this paper give a valuable PD characteristic interpretation and further research of PD pattern identification.
